Movie Trivia: The Sarah Connor Chronicles Roll On

At this point, I’m really rather confused. The Sarah Connor Chronicles, yet another knee-jerk sci-fi show from Fox that’ll be lucky to last three seasons, has been renewed for a second season. By all accounts, the best people can say about this show is that it’s action-packed; reading several reviews has shown that’s the nicest (and most repeated) thing that can be said for it. Meanwhile, detractors are quick to point out the new Terminator’s frequent propensity for wisecracks (did Skynet install a classic action hero mode while we were away?) and relative lack of substance.

Oh, and let’s not forget the season one finale—several audience members are STILL moaning over that train wreck. But let’s be honest. Broadcast TV has been steadily crumbling for years. Aside from a handful of bright spots, most shows that debut on television will be gone in a year or less. I’ve seen some shows that can’t last more than four episodes before getting the axe. Several die after the pilot!

Which means, anything even vaguely good, which The Sarah Connor Chronicles can be described as—loosely—qualifies for second season status.
